River Birch Trimming in Allentown, PA
River Birch trimming services involve carefully shaping and reducing the size of river birch trees to maintain their health, appearance, and safety. This service typically covers pruning overgrown branches, removing dead or damaged limbs, and managing the overall form of the tree to prevent potential hazards or property damage. Property owners often request river birch trimming to improve the tree’s aesthetic appeal, promote better growth, or to address safety concerns caused by weak or falling branches.
Before requesting river birch trimming, homeowners should consider the current condition of their trees, including any signs of disease, damage, or overgrowth. It’s also helpful to understand the desired outcome, whether that’s a more uniform shape, clearance from structures or power lines, or simply removing problematic limbs. Proper knowledge of the tree’s health and growth pattern can assist in planning the most effective trimming approach, ensuring the tree remains healthy and visually pleasing.

River Birch Trimming Questions
What is the purpose of trimming River Birch trees? Trimming helps maintain the tree’s health, remove dead or damaged branches, and shape the tree for aesthetic appeal.
When is the best time to trim River Birch trees?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.
What tools are used for River Birch trimming? Pruning shears, loppers, and saws are commonly used to carefully remove unwanted branches.
Are there any risks associated with trimming River Birch trees? Improper trimming can cause stress or damage to the tree, so proper technique is important for healthy growth.
